Best time to ski in Le Grand-Bornand
With altitudes of over 2000 metres, and a sizable band of snow cannons covering the main runs, Le Grand-Bornand is pretty reliable for snow. That said, the best dumps usually fall in February and March.
Short of time? With quick and easy access from Geneva airport, Le Grand-Bornand is spot on for a long weekend break. And look out for dates of the French Biathlon World Cup in December.

Things to do in Le Grand-Bornand
Love cheese? Then you’re going to love Le Grand Bornand. Well-known for its locally produced Reblochon, you’ll find tartiflette and fondue on every menu in town. And don’t miss the weekly farmers market to pick some up for the journey home.
If you fancy a break from skiing, why not treat the family to a horse-drawn sleigh ride through whimsical snowy meadows, book an adrenaline-fuelled fat bike excursion, or indulge your competitive streak with some good old-fashioned sledge racing. Allez, allez, allez!
